How to create Christmas greeting card with snowflakes and colorful tree baubles in Photoshop CS5

Now we have to represent the snow. In this case create a new layer and use on it the Hard brush of white color.
Use this brush to draw many small circles. Choose different Brush size and different Opacity value for brushes.
We’ve got the next result:
Set the Blending mode for this layer to Soft Light.
Make a copy of the last made layer and select the Free Transform (Ctrl+T) command to turn around the copy’s layer. Change the Blending mode for this layer to Normal.
Insert the mask on the layer by choosing Add layer mask on the bottom part of the Layers panel and choose the Hard Round brush of black color (set Opacity to 40% in Options bar).
Paint in the mask using this bursh to hide several snow zones as it is shown below.
Insert the message text for greeting card. Select the Horizontal Type tool (T). Select a font, size and color in the Character panel.
Click in the canvas and type ‘Merry Christmas’. Press Enter to apply the text.
